Contents

Bonding Requirements

Amphipteres seem to require a relatively large amount of theology to bond, requires more than 50 but less than 100.

To bond to one, you will likely need to join an association that gives theology access: Agnihotri, Almerian Inquisition, or another association one.

Known Abilities

The amphiptere is a winged, flying snake that can be found in Tetlacana, specifically in Tlaxcala. It is truly an immense creature, with a body normally over three dimins thick and fifty-seven or more dimins long. It is a terrifying opponent, with a poison spit attack and enormous bite. It requires air to breathe, has a carnivorous diet and can see in the dark. It is an excellent mount.
